MOTOR VEHICLE MAINTENANCE AND REPAIR SHOP SPECIALIZED EQUIPMENT is a federal award for Fa4830 23 Cons Cc held by A3 Systems Corp. Estimated value $159K ($159K obligated). Current period of performance ends Sep 30, 2025. Last award drew 1 bidder. Place of performance: CHESTER VA.

Recompete timing

Public
Past PoP end (325 days ago)

Current PoP ended Sep 30, 2025 (325 days ago). The usual 12–18 month agency planning window is closed — recompete action looks late / overdue relative to a normal cycle. Watch for bridge orders, follow-ons, or a new solicitation.
